Basic Working Mechanism

Before we plunge into its myriad uses, it’s crucial to understand the essential operation of a reciprocating saw. Unlike circular saws that rotate a blade continuously, reciprocating saws utilize a back-and-forth motion. This motion, powered by an internal motor, moves the saw blade rapidly as it cuts through materials. This unique operation gives reciprocating saws their name and distinctive cutting action.

Essential Uses of Reciprocating Saws

Demolition and Renovation 

Reciprocating saws excel in demolition and renovation projects, where precision is secondary to raw cutting power. They are adept at slashing through wood, nails, and even masonry. Their ability to get into tight spaces inaccessible to bulkier saws makes them invaluable.

Specialized Applications

Rough Cutting

When a perfect, symmetrical cut is not a priority, reciprocating saws can be used for rough cutting in construction materials. Thicker blades are utilized for durability. They can efficiently tackle applications like cutting trenches, openings in walls, and shaping irregular surfaces.

Rough cutting with a reciprocating saw requires understanding the tool’s capabilities and the right approach to ensure efficiency and safety. For tackling tasks such as cutting trenches or making openings in walls, follow these steps:

  1. Select the Correct Blade: Choose a long, sturdy blade for the material you cut through. Use a wood cutting blade with fewer, more prominent teeth for rough cutting in wood. For mixed materials, a combination blade can be more effective.
  2. Mark Your Cutting Area: Precision may not be your main priority, but it’s still important to mark the area where you’ll be cutting to avoid unnecessary damage to surrounding materials.
  3. Ensure Safety: Always wear protective gear, including safety glasses and gloves. Ensure the area is secure and there’s no risk of hitting electrical lines or plumbing.
  4. Set the Saw: If your saw has variable speed, start at a lower setting to initiate the cut and increase speed as needed. This will help control the saw and prevent it from jumping.
  5. Use the Right Technique: Hold the saw with both hands and position your body to maintain control. Begin the cut by gently placing the saw blade against the material. Apply steady pressure and allow the saw to work; forcing it can cause the blade to bend or break.
  6. Follow Through: Keep the saw moving straight, following the marked path. If the blade gets stuck, don’t force it. Instead, stop the saw, pull it out gently, and reposition it before continuing.
  7. Cool Down: For extended cutting, periodically allow the saw and blade to cool down to extend their life and maintain performance.

By following these steps, users can leverage the versatility of a reciprocating saw for rough-cutting applications, making quick work of otherwise labor-intensive tasks. Remember, the key is to work safely and efficiently, taking advantage of this powerful tool’s full potential.

Cutting Holes in Materials

Beyond rough cutting, reciprocating saws can be used to cut holes in materials, providing a unique utility for interior decoration or construction purposes where shaping or creating voids is necessary.

Cutting Holes in Materials Using a reciprocating saw requires precision, a steady hand, and the proper technique to achieve clean and precise cuts. Follow these steps to use your reciprocating effectively saw for this application:

  1. Select the Appropriate Blade: Use a fine-toothed blade suitable for the material you’re working with for cutting holes. Metal blades are great for sheet materials, while wood blades work well for softer materials.
  2. Mark the Hole: Outline the hole you intend to cut. For circular holes, draw your circle using a compass or a template. For square or rectangular holes, use a straightedge to ensure clean lines.
  3. Drill a Starter Hole: Before using the reciprocating saw, drill a hole inside your marked area. This starter hole will serve as the entry point for your saw blade.
  4. Insert the Blade Into the Starter Hole: Carefully insert the saw blade into the starter hole. Ensure the saw is unplugged or the battery is removed during this step to maintain safety.
  5. Begin Cutting: Reconnect power to the saw. With a firm grip on the saw, begin cutting along the inside edge of your marked area. Use a steady speed, letting the saw do the work without applying excessive force. For smoother operation, you can utilize the variable speed setting if available.
  6. Maintain Control: Keep a steady hand and follow the line closely. Using your saw with an orbital action setting can make the cut smoother. Still, it might require practice to control accurately.
  7. Proceed Slowly Around Turns: For corners or curves, slow down to maintain control and precision. Stop the saw to reposition your hands or adjust your stance for better leverage and sight lines if necessary.
  8. Finish the Cut: Continue until the cut is complete. If cutting out a piece, support it as you complete it to prevent it from falling and causing damage or injury.
  9. Clean Up the Edges: There might be rough edges or minor deviations from your line after cutting. Use a file or sandpaper to clean up these areas for a neat finish.

Cutting holes using a reciprocating saw might seem challenging initially. Still, with the proper preparation and practice, it becomes a valuable technique for custom cuts and openings in various materials. Always prioritize safety by wearing appropriate protective gear and following the tool’s usage guidelines.

Resawing Small Logs

Woodworkers often employ reciprocating saws for resawing small logs into manageable pieces for further processing. This illustrates the finesse with which reciprocating saws can be used, transitioning from heavy-duty tasks to delicate woodworking applications.

Resawing small logs into planks or smaller sections can be highly rewarding, yielding materials for various projects. Here’s how to effectively use a reciprocating saw for this task:

  1. Select a Suitable Blade: For resawing logs, choose a long, durable blade with a tooth configuration designed for wood cutting, ideally one that can handle the log’s diameter.
  2. Secure the Log: Stability is vital when cutting. Secure the log using clamps or a vise to prevent it from moving during the cutting process.
  3. Mark Your Cut: Decide on the thickness of the sections or planks you wish to cut and mark these measurements clearly on the log. This step ensures uniformity in your cuts.
  4. Wear Safety Gear: Always wear protective gear, including safety goggles, gloves, and hearing protection, to safeguard against flying debris, dust, and loud noise.
  5. Start Cutting: Begin your cut steadily with the reciprocating saw set at a low to medium speed. It is essential to allow the saw to do the work rather than forcing it through the log. Maintain a firm grip and control over the saw at all times.
  6. Follow Your Marks: Carefully follow the marks you’ve made on the log. Stop occasionally to ensure the cut is straight, and adjust your approach as needed.
  7. Rotate the Log: Once you’ve cut partway through the log, you may need to rotate it to complete the cut from another angle. This ensures a clean through-cut and reduces the chance of the blade getting stuck.
  8. Complete Your Cut: Continue until the section has been entirely severed from the log. If necessary, sand the cut surfaces to remove any roughness or splinters.
  9. Cool Down: After extended use, allow the saw and blade to cool down before proceeding with additional cuts or changing the blade.

By following these steps, woodworkers and hobbyists can seamlessly and efficiently resaw small logs into valuable materials with a reciprocating saw, showcasing its versatility beyond traditional demolition and rough-cutting tasks.

Safety Considerations

Although reciprocating saws are handy, their power should be wielded with the utmost care. Safety measures include wearing appropriate protective gear such as dust masks, gloves, and safety glasses and ensuring a firm grip during operation to maintain control.

Selecting the Right Blade

The choice of blade is critical to the effectiveness of a reciprocating saw for a specific task. Understanding the various types of blades and how they affect cutting efficiency is paramount. Different blades serve different purposes, from wood with coarse teeth to metals with fine teeth. Additionally, specialized blades can serve niche applications, like pruning blades for gardening tasks.

Here’s an overview of the different types of blades available:

  • Wood Cutting Blades: Designed with coarse teeth, these blades are ideal for cutting through lumber, plywood, and other wood materials. They can cut quickly but may leave a rougher edge.
  • Metal Cutting Blades: These blades have finer teeth and are made to cut through metal pipes, sheets, and profiles. Their design reduces the risk of sparks and ensures a smoother cut in metal materials.
  • Bi-Metal Blades: Combining the durability of steel with the cutting efficiency of high-speed steel teeth, bi-metal blades are versatile and longer-lasting. They’re suitable for cutting wood and metal, making them a great all-purpose option.
  • Demolition Blades: Made to handle a variety of materials, including wood with nails, plastics, and even non-ferrous metals. These blades are thicker and more durable, designed to withstand the rigors of demolition work.
  • Pruning Blades: With a coarse tooth configuration, pruning blades are tailored for outdoor work, such as cutting tree branches and shrubs. They cut quickly through green wood and are often longer to reach.
  • Carbide-Tipped Blades: These are designed for cutting through more complex materials, such as stainless steel, cast iron, and fiberglass, more efficiently. The carbide tips extend the blade’s lifespan and maintain sharpness for longer.
  • Diamond Grit Blades: Ideal for cutting through rigid materials like cast iron, glass, tile, and stone. These blades grind rather than slice through the material and are known for their durability and longevity.

Selecting the right blade ensures the job gets done right and extends the life of both your blades and reciprocating saw. Consider the material you’re cutting and the desired outcome when choosing a blade.

Advantages of Cordless Models

  • Enhanced Mobility: Cordless reciprocating saws allow unrestricted movement around the job site without needing access to electrical outlets or being hindered by tangled cords.
  • Safety: With no cords to trip over, cordless models significantly reduce the risk of accidents, making them safer to use in cluttered or busy environments.
  • Versatility: Their portability makes cordless saws ideal for tasks in remote or hard-to-reach locations where power access is limited or non-existent.
  • Convenience: Quick and easy to set up, cordless saws eliminate the time spent unraveling and managing extension cords, thereby increasing productivity.
  • Improved Ergonomics: Often designed with the user in mind, cordless models tend to be lighter and easier to handle, reducing fatigue during extended use.
  • Battery Compatibility: Many cordless reciprocating saws are part of a larger platform of tools that share the same battery type, simplifying battery management and reducing overall costs.
